Hikone Port is located in Hikone City, Shiga Prefecture, Japan, on the shore of Lake Biwa. Its history is deeply connected to the transportation of Lake Biwa and the development of Hikone Castle. First of all, Lake Biwa has been used as an important water transportation route since ancient times, and Hikone Port also functioned as a part of it. During the Edo period, goods and people were transported through the lake, and Hikone Port played a role as a collection point for goods. It is said that materials were transported through the lake during the construction of Hikone Castle. Since the Meiji period, even though transportation methods have changed, Hikone Port has played an important role as a hub for tourism and local transportation. Especially since the beginning of modern times, tourism around Lake Biwa has become popular, and lake sightseeing boats have begun to depart from Hikone Port. Pleasure boats for tourists are still in operation today, and it is known as a tourist destination along with Hikone Castle. Currently, Hikone Port is mainly used for tourism purposes, but it is also useful for local life and transportation. Pleasure boats operate regularly to enjoy the beautiful scenery of Lake Biwa, and play an important role in the tourism industry. The history of Hikone Port has greatly contributed to the development of transportation and economy centered around Lake Biwa.

Depart from here for Chikubu Island. It is quite far from Hikone station. It might be a little difficult to walk. It may be possible to visit Hikone Castle and then walk. This time we used the free shuttle bus from Hikone Station. The flight departed 30 minutes before departure. Even if you use a car, there is a large bicycle parking lot, so you can rest assured. 40 minutes one way to Chikubu Island. You can enjoy it together with sightseeing at Hikone Castle.

My child wanted to go on a boat, so we took a sightseeing boat around Takeijima. The price is reasonable and you can go and return in about an hour. Parking is free and the restrooms are clean. The people at the reception and guiding the ship were very friendly and made me feel comfortable. The second floor of the ferry has open seats, so we were able to enjoy the breeze from the lake, and even though it was a midsummer day (probably around 35 degrees Celsius), it was cool and we could stare at the lake all the time. Takeijima looks like a rocky mountain, and walking to the tip was nerve-wracking. My 4 year old was able to walk with it, but it's dangerous if you don't keep an eye on it!
